Tallawhalt Housing Project, Swinomish Housing Authority

Swinomish, Washington 

Akana provided A/E design and construction administration services for development of affordable single-family housing located in the Tallawhalt Subdivision on the Swinomish Reservation in La Conner, WA.  Set within a rural hilltop tribal housing community, the site includes 14 platted lots of approximately 30,000 square feet each.   The project involved design of 16 two- and three-bedroom single family homes, 8 of which are Type A accessible units dedicated to elder housing.  Single-family home lots accommodate two residences per lot, reducing impacts to the site and encouraging a vibrant connected community. 

Site work involved design of new sanitary sewer, water, street and storm drainage improvements, and grading plans were developed to accommodate wet weather construction on the sloping site. 

To find a housing type and project delivery method appropriate to Swinomish tribal life and the project budget, the Akana team worked with focus groups to identify housing design preferences, develop project design guidelines and sustainability goals and strategies.  We worked with the Swinomish Housing Authority to determine the feasibility of various building methodologies including conventional stick framed, panelized and modular housing, and recommended the most appropriate building methodology for the housing project. 

The homes were designed with SIP panels, heat recovery ventilators and healthy flooring surfaces, contributing to the Housing Authority’s goals for long-term durability, healthy indoor environment and low costs for tenants.
